Cast Date Haydite Girder (HG) Stalite Girder (SG) Utelite Girder (UG) Stalite ... blephex procedural refill packsWebb26 apr. 2024 · Lightweight concrete (LWC) can reduce the self-weight of structures and can save material and labour costs in industry. Despite these merits, the application of lightweight concrete is mostly limited because of low compressive strength, often <60 MPa; and low workability, due to high absorption capacity and possibility of aggregates … fred bellan facebookWebbStalite Lightweight Aggregate.
